This match analysis will focus on the A-League Women's match between Melbourne City FC (Woman) and Adelaide United (Wom) that took place on 29th January 2023.

Melbourne City FC emerged as the winners with a slim 1-0 victory, distinguishing itself from Adelaide United through decisive shooting and robust defending. The solitary goal of the match came 53 minutes into the second half. Despite Adelaide United exerting significant pressure, they were unable to convert their efforts into a goal.

Corner kicks were a significant factor in this match, providing a good measure of each team's attacking pressure. Adelaide United had more corner kicks with 4 as opposed to Melbourne City's 2, suggesting Adelaide United had more attacking opportunities. Despite this advantage, they were unable to convert these set-piece opportunities into goals.

Melbourne City FC adopted a tougher approach to this game evident in the fact that they picked up two yellow cards during the match. Despite the risk associated with such a strategy, it may have been a determining factor in conserving the team's slim lead. Adelaide United, on the other hand, did not receive any cards – exhibiting a cleaner style of play but it was not enough to break through Melbourne's defense.

Looking at the data, one could argue that Melbourne City FC's approach of prioritizing defense and taking a physical stand has been crucial to their win in this closely fought match. Adelaide United's failure to capitalize on their set-pieces might be a key area they will want to work on going ahead.

In conclusion, this match provides an interesting case of a match that has been won on the virtue of discipline, effective strategy, and resilient defending. Melbourne City FC was able to safeguard their lead despite the pressure from Adelaide United and overcome them with a single goal.
